Broken Sword 2 Being Remastered
by Alice O'Connor, Dec 10, 2010 7:00am PSTRevolution Software has announced that its 1997 adventure game sequel Broken Sword - The Smoking Mirror is receive a revamped new version, much as it tarted up Beneath a Steel Sky and the original Broken Sword: Shadow of the Templars.
Broken Sword - The Smoking Mirror: Remastered boasts fancier graphics, enhanced sound, animated facial expressions, a hint-system and diary. Intriguingly, Dropbox integration will enable cross-platform saved games. There's also a new "interactive digital comic" by 'Watchmen' artist and long-time Revolution collaborator Dave Gibbons.
Broken Sword - The Smoking Mirror: Remastered is to be released for iOS devices "very shortly," followed by PC and Mac editions "very early next year." Pricing has yet to be announced yet. For reference, Broken Sword: Shadow of the Templars- Director's Cut currently costs $4.99 for PC, iPhone and iPod Touch and $7.99 on iPad.
